Property Details for 34 Walker St, Redfern

34 Walker St, Redfern is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om House. The property has a land size of 108m2 and floor size of 78m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in February 2024.

Last Listing description (November 2020)

Original homes in the inner city suburbs are particularly sought-after and this wide-fronted terrace offers boundless potential and is basically a blank canvas ready for transformation into something befitting its fashionable urban village setting. Set on the high side of the street on the border of Surry Hills, the two-storey home presents an exciting prospect for renovation with potential to open out the rear of the home to engage with the level garden as well as scope for an attic conversion (STCA). Offering superb value and an ideal opportunity for the keen renovator or developer, the 6m fronted terrace is in a fantastic city fringe location, two blocks back from Crown Street's dining hub and a few hundred metres to Prince Alfred Park. It's a great market entry ideal for those wanting to make their mark in this inner city hotspot.

- End of row terrace, extra wide and freestanding to one side
- An exciting prospect, in need of renovation works

- Prime investment, first time offered for sale in almost 30 years
- 2 upper level double bedrooms and a lower level study area
- Open plan living and dining, exposed brickwork, high ceilings
- Dine-in gas kitchen and a large bathroom with a bathtub
- Sunny level garden with rear pedestrian access via Centre St
- Pitched roofline with potential to develop the roof space STCA
- 500m to Prince Alfred Park's recreational hub and outdoor pool
- Metres to Surry Hills village and Crown Street's dining precinct
- Stroll to Redfern Park and the soon-to-be-upgraded station
- 8 min walk to Central Station

About Redfern 2016

The size of Redfern is approximately 1.2 square kilometres. It has 21 parks covering nearly 8.1% of total area. The population of Redfern in 2011 was 12,034 people. By 2016 the population was 13,218 showing a population growth of 9.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Redfern is 20-29 years. Households in Redfern are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Redfern work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 38.2% of the homes in Redfern were owner-occupied compared with 33.5% in 2016.

Redfern has 7,986 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Redfern have seen a 31.44%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 15.37% increase. As at 28 February 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Redfern is $2,062,248 while the median value for Units is $1,145,997.
  • Houses have a median rent of $993 while Units have a median rent of $800.
There are currently 19 properties listed for sale, and 32 properties listed for rent in Redfern on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 325 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Redfern.
